4 Essential High-Fashion Items for Men in Spring 2020


While it may seem like everyone is still in winter mode, designers are already looking ahead to the spring, filling the runways with all the must-have fashion pieces. For men looking to get that jump start on the must-have fashion items, we’ve gone ahead and rounded up four essential high-fashion items that you’ll want to add to your wardrobe. Some of these pieces can even be worked into your existing winter-wear depending on how you style them.



Designer Sneakers
Here’s an item that consistently pops up on all the hottest runways year after year, and that’s designer sneakers. For men, this can be an incredibly trendy piece to add to their wardrobe that is also versatile in that they can be paired with your dressy trousers and your designer denim.

The 90s Cargo Trousers Return
Trends are well-known for repeating themselves decades later, and this year's repeat trend is looking to be the 90s style cargo trousers. Think baggie and loose to really pull off this trend, complete with a cinched or drawstring waist to give it edge. Now, if you want to appeal to high-fashion, then be sure to opt for those oversized cargo pockets, rather than the sleek ones.



Anything in Satin
While this isn't a specific item, it is a fabric you're going to want to keep an eye on. A big trend among menswear designers for spring/summer 2020 has been the use of satin. Whether it is a satin bomber jacket, overcoat, slacks, blazer, or shirts, this fabric is proving to be "the" fabric of the upcoming season. 
You can also add your own flair to the trend by opting for prints and bold colors. As a bonus, this fabric is incredibly comfortable and lightweight, making it ideal for the warmer temperatures to come.



Bust Out the Oxford Shirt
Sure, an Oxford style shirt may not sound high-fashion, but it's all in the way it's worn and styled. This shirt has also worked its way onto the runways of such top designers as Liam Hodges and Prada, being paired with trousers and shorts alike. It's all about the 90s preppy look.
